Buffalo Central Terminal
Ruins of a once-prized Art Deco railroad station in Buffalo, New York, now undergoing restoration and open for public events and tours.

šŸ“œ Impressive historic Art Deco railway station, a symbol of abandonment now being restored.
šŸ” Built in 1929, served as a key railroad station for 50 years.
